The Emotional Turn in The Simpsons Season 36 Finale

The popular animated series The Simpsons has once again captured the attention of its audience with a dramatic and unexpected turn in its latest season finale. Titled ‘Estranger Things,’ the episode aired on May 18 and is notable for revealing the death of one of the show’s most beloved characters, Marge Simpson, through a forward-looking flash of 35 years into the future.

How Did Marge Die?

The episode showcases a future where Marge is no longer alive, with her passing depicted at her tombstone during a memorial scene. Her children, Bart, Lisa, and Maggie, are shown as adults dealing with her loss. Interestingly, Lisa becomes the commissioner of the NBA, while Bart runs an unlicensed old age home where Homer lives without Marge. The episode also features a heartfelt letter from Marge, expressing her hopes for her children to remain connected and cherish their bond.

In a touching moment, Lisa refers to her mother as ‘late mother’ and reflects on her doubts about surviving her husband, Homer. The episode ends with the siblings watching their favorite childhood show, ‘The Itchy & Scratchy Show,’ while Marge looks down from heaven, symbolizing her continued presence in their lives.

The Afterlife and Unexpected Marriages

Adding a humorous twist, the episode reveals that Marge has remarried Ringo Starr, the legendary drummer of The Beatles, in heaven. Ringo surprises her by joking about the upcoming Heaven buffet, and they share a tender moment, highlighting a playful take on their afterlife marriage. This unexpected development adds a layer of comedy and fantasy to the episode’s emotional narrative.

The revelation of Marge’s death has sparked widespread reactions among fans, with many expressing shock and sadness. On social media, viewers shared sentiments like ‘You just ruined my day’ and questioned why other characters like Patty or Selma were not chosen for such a fate. Some fans also compared this storyline to other adult animated series, noting the trend of killing off main characters to create shock value.

While some critics see this as a ways to redefine the show’s legacy, others believe it marks a shift away from the show’s traditional humor towards more profound storytelling. Despite mixed reactions, the series is set to continue with four more seasons, although with a reduced episode count, signaling a new phase in its long-running history.
